About This Book

Pretty Ellen Whitaker, R.N., faces a choice between the handsome doctor she loves and the dark suspicions that threaten to ruin him.

Why did the people of Barfield avoid their hospital? Why did they whisper "criminal" about its director, Dr. Jerry Sterling, when they talked of the mysterious death of his beautiful wife, Naomi? And what was driving Naomi's brother, Henry Barfield, to use his membership on the hospital board to ruin Dr. Sterling?

Desperately, pretty Ellen struggled to find the answers. Pitted against her consuming love for Jerry Sterling were the hostility of her neighbors and the terrible suspicions she could not shake free from her own mind. In a story shaken with passion, hiding at its heart a dreadful secret, Ellen Whitaker finds herself all but alone as the nurse against the town.
